Foreign Branch Setup Overview

A foreign branch setup generally refers to establishing a branch office or similar business presence in another country through an existing company. It is often used by businesses that want to expand operations internationally while maintaining direct linkage with the parent entity.

A branch office is usually not treated in the same way as a separate incorporated subsidiary. Its legal, tax, regulatory, and operational treatment depends on the laws of the country where it is being established. Because of this, businesses must carefully review the legal framework, registration requirements, local approvals, and reporting obligations before proceeding.

The right setup depends on several factors, including the nature of business activities, the country involved, ownership structure, regulatory restrictions, tax exposure, and long-term business goals.

Why Foreign Branch Setup Needs Proper Planning

International expansion is not only a growth opportunity. It also comes with legal, tax, and compliance responsibilities. A poorly planned branch setup can create issues around registration, banking, taxation, repatriation, approvals, and ongoing reporting.

Proper planning helps businesses:

  • choose the right expansion structure

  • understand local legal requirements

  • prepare necessary documents correctly

  • reduce regulatory and procedural delays

  • align the setup with business goals

  • manage tax and compliance risks better

  • create a smoother market entry process

When the setup is planned properly, the branch can support growth instead of creating avoidable complications.

Common Challenges in Foreign Branch Setup

Companies often face practical and legal difficulties when planning a foreign branch. Common issues include:

  • confusion between branch office and subsidiary structure

  • lack of clarity on local registration requirements

  • incomplete documentation

  • regulatory restrictions in the destination country

  • tax and reporting concerns

  • banking and operational setup difficulties

  • uncertainty regarding parent company liability

  • poor coordination between legal and business planning

A proper advisory-led approach helps reduce these risks and improves execution.
